📢 BIG NEWS FOR NORTH DAVIESS BUSINESSES! 🚀

You might have seen the headlines in the local papers—now it’s official! The North Daviess Community Growth Alliance (NDCGA) has officially secured public funding for downtown revitalization, and we are ready to roll!
We are officially launching the 2026 North Daviess Façade Grant Program, and the Call for Projects is NOW OPEN!

🏢 What is the Façade Grant Program?

If you are a business owner in the North Daviess community, this program is designed for you. NDCGA is offering reimbursement grants for completed façade improvement projects. Whether it’s fresh paint, updated signage, historic restoration, or a complete storefront face-lift, we want to help you elevate your business and beautify our downtowns!

North Daviess Community Growth Alliance Façade Grant Program
By Staff Reports
The North Daviess Growth Alliance met with the Odon Town Council during its regular monthly meeting to discuss a proposed façade grant program designed to enhance and revitalize the downtown area.

The council was been asked to contribute $10,000 to help launch the initiative. The funding would be used as a 1-to-1 matching grant program for local business owners, encouraging investment in storefront improvements with the goal of increasing downtown foot traffic and overall economic activity.

Alliance representatives emphasized that the initiative is intended not only to improve downtown aesthetics, but also to demonstrate how targeted funding can serve as effective seed money for broader community development. By matching local investment dollar-for-dollar, the program aims to encourage business owners to take an active role in upgrading and modernizing their properties.

Similar façade grant programs have been successfully implemented in nearby communities, including Washington, where downtown revitalization efforts have led to visible improvements and increased activity.

The program was approved and will provide Odon business owners with an opportunity to enhance storefronts, strengthen the downtown business district, and support long-term community growth.
